Should I Sell My House Now? 7 Great Reasons To List This Spring—and 3 Times You Might Want To Wait
April 19, 2023 | Posted by: Angela Robinson
As the spring selling season gets underway, homeowners are weighing the advantages of selling now, against the disadvantages of a stressed housing market. Home prices have remained cyclical, with the median list price of a home rising from $406,000 in January to $424,000 in March, up 6.3% from the same period last year. The higher the owner's equity in a home, the less mortgage rates will factor in as all-cash offers put them in a stronger position. The national supply of homes for sale is at a rock-bottom low, down to less than half the pre-pandemic number, meaning any new listings are likely to gain a lot of attention, and the process of selling a house has become more flexible and faster than in the past. However, this spring's housing market is more financially hampered than in previous years, which has led many potential sellers to adopt a wait-and-see approach. Although the Fannie Mae Home Purchase Sentiment Index found that the share of sellers who believe now is a good time to sell has dropped by 18% annually, the outlook for home sales remains positive. Nonetheless, homeowners should weigh the advantages and disadvantages of selling now based on their individual circumstances.
